W. H. Wernsdorfer is a scholar working on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Pharmacology and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, W. H. Wernsdorfer has authored 33 papers receiving a total of 709 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 27 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, 7 papers in Pharmacology and 5 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in W. H. Wernsdorfer’s work include Malaria Research and Control (26 papers), Mosquito-borne diseases and control (12 papers) and Mechanisms of Drug-Induced Hepatotoxicity (6 papers). W. H. Wernsdorfer is often cited by papers focused on Malaria Research and Control (26 papers), Mosquito-borne diseases and control (12 papers) and Mechanisms of Drug-Induced Hepatotoxicity (6 papers). W. H. Wernsdorfer collaborates with scholars based in Austria, Switzerland and Malaysia. W. H. Wernsdorfer's co-authors include V. Navaratnam, U K Sheth, David Payne, Anders Björkman and Marian Warsame and has published in prestigious journals such as Antimicrobial Agents and Chemotherapy, Journal of Antimicrobial Chemotherapy and American Journal of Tropical Medicine and Hygiene.
